The Birth of the Millennium is translated from the Third Reich original Die Geburt des Jahrtausends, which was published in 1936 and dedicated to his sons Jörg and Wulf. The author, Kurt Eggers, was the editor of the SS newspaper Das Schwarze Korps and an SS war correspondent. After he was killed on the Russian front in 1943, an SS regiment was named after him: the SS-Standarte Kurt Eggers.
